Purpose:
To assist Cancer Genetics staff in preparing for genetic counselling appointments.
Requirements:
- Strong attention to detail
- Comfort with computer software
- Understanding of general pedigree structure
- Able to work independently and as part of a multi-disciplinary team
- Able to speak with patients on the phone
- Quick to learn new skills
- Self-motivated and able to take initiative
Duties:
- Read and understand family history questionnaires that have been completed by patients.
- Assist in referral triage and data entry.
- Patient phone calls to obtain email addresses, pedigree updates, personal information and/or booking appointments.
- Enter family histories into Progeny, our patient database.
- Accurately construct pedigrees according to proper format, including taking phone pedigrees.
- Assisting with Release of Information requests.
- Performing literature reviews and presenting at team journal clubs.
- Assisting with collection of test requisitions and tracking genetic testing samples and writing template letters as needed.
- Filing, faxing, photocopying and other office duties.
- Occasionally assist with other projects, if necessary.
